Stratigraphy
Formation: | Boas River | ||||
Stratigraphic resolution: | group of beds | ||||
Stratigraphy comments: Was Maysvillian. However, Zhang (2017: CJES) notes that it is in the Amplexograptus inuiti zone. Zhang also notes that the Boas River is not a proper unit, and that these are just lower beds of the Foster Bay formation. |
